Abstract

We describe a new species of small diurnal frog of the genus Gephyromantis from Mahasoa, a fragment of mid-altitude rainforest in the northern central east of Madagascar, located to the north east of Lake Alaotra. Analysis of DNA sequences of the mitochondrial 16S rRNA and cytochrome b genes and of the nuclear Rag 1 gene indicate that Gephyromantis mafy sp. nov. is closely related to G. eiselti and G. thelenae, that it is genetically distinct and when compared with the genetic diversity of all species in the genus shows genetic differences similar to other pairs of species. These three species are morphologically almost indistinguishable but the new species differs by a relevant and consistent genetic divergence in all markers studied, and by its advertisement calls composed of note series. The call is intermediate between G. eiselti and G. thelenae, showing shorter note duration and higher repetition rate than in G. thelenae and slightly longer note duration but lower repetition rate than in G. eiselti. The new species is known only from Mahasoa forest but due to its secretive habits and cryptic morphology, we assume that it is more widespread in the mid-altitude rainforests east and north of Lake Alaotra that so far have been very poorly surveyed. We propose a Red List status of Data Deficient for the new species. Copyright © 2012 · Magnolia Press.
